Chief Olson explained that he has one man left on the first certifi-
cation list of recruits for the Fire Department and that the second
list ' s time limit has run out . Olson continued that the last name
on the list is not a desirable candidate because of past work records
and with the Fire Department presently having two openings , he would
ask the Civil Service Commission to conduct a Fire Recruitment Exam.
Rodemeyer reported that the support staff of the Commission could
have some of the details for the recruit exam worked out by the
December meeting for their approval .
Braun asked for an update on the litigation filed by several members
from the Waterloo Police Department .
Kennedy reported that the Courts filed an injunction against the Civil
Service Commission to stop any promotional exams and then the individuals
filed a cross petition with the Courts which was unclear to Mr . Kennedy .
Kennedy continued that this is where the situation stands at the present
time .
Randall stated that the Commission would like a hearing on the temporary
injunction to either dissolve the injunction or to make it permanent .
Motion by Randall to direct the City Attorney to file with the Courts
a request for a hearing to dissolve the temporary injunction as soon
as possible . Seconded by Eibey. Motion carried.
Mogle stated that in regard to the residency requirements that the City
places on its employees , this may be in conflict with Civil Service
Law.
Kennedy explained the history of the requirements of becoming a Civil
Service employee . He then continued that the Supreme Court has ruled
the cities do have a right to require their employees to be residents
of the city .
Mogle stated that he interpreted the section of Civil Service Law that
deals with the requirements of not being a resident of the City as
meaning for the condition of employment .
Kennedy stated that he has discussed this with the Mayor and he feels
very strongly in support of employees living within the corporate limits
of the City.
-2- Civil Service Commission
Discussion followed concerning some of the procedures that would have to
be followed if the entire City were to be placed under Civil Service
Law.

Braun explained that the Commission had not set out a cut-off point
for Fire Chief interviews due to the fact that they were unaware of
the scoring procedure of the Fire Extension Service of Ames , Iowa.
Braun then announced the Fire Chief scores ran from 54 . 32% thru 80 . 637 .
Motion by Eibey that any score above 50 . 00% is to be included in the
list for Fire Chief. Seconded by Braun . Motion Carried.
